With HyperComply's Slack integration, it’s easier than ever to share specific questions with your team members and get them answered quickly. You can do this through a direct message to an individual or posting the question to a channel.

Connecting your HyperComply Organization to Slack

To connect your company Slack to your HyperComply workspace, go to the Settings tab, click Integrations and add to Slack. [If the Slack integration doesn’t show in your account ask your CSM to turn on the integration capabilities.]

  • A user who is an Admin of both HyperComply and Slack needs to allow this integration
    • Admins can allow this integration by selecting configure apps in the admin portal. Then on the app management page, select App Management Settings and toggle off the Only allow apps from the Slack App Directory.
  • If you have multiple Slack workspaces, you can select your organization from the dropdown menu

  • Click Allow, then you will automatically be brought back to HyperComply settings

 

Connecting your Individual HyperComply Account to Slack

  • Click Sign in with Slack to connect as a user
    • Each user in your HyperComply workspace is required to sign into their Slack account before they are able to answer questions sent via Slack

  • Once the new page opens, click "Allow"

That's it! Slack has now been successfully authorized for your workspace.
